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Sudbury (Suffolk) to Rickmansworth start from £47.40 one way, or £47.50 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Sudbury (Suffolk) to Rickmansworth are available for £51.40 one way, or £76.10 return

Station Facilities

Though Sudbury (Suffolk) station does not have a ticket office, it is equipped with ticket machines that allow you to pick up tickets purchased online with ease. The ticket machines are accessible, and an induction loop is available to assist hearing-impaired passengers. Smartcards cannot be issued at the station, but you will find validators for them should you need to use one.

CCTV is present to ensure your security while at the station, reflecting a strong commitment to traveler safety. Sadly, there are no toilets, refreshment facilities, or shopping outlets available within the station, so plan accordingly before you journey. Assistance is on hand via a help point if you need, and there are clear announcements and departure screens to keep you informed.

A Smooth and Accessible Journey

Accessibility at Sudbury (Suffolk) train station ensures that each passenger, including those with disabilities, travels comfortably. The station offers step-free access across the platform, making it straightforward to navigate. Though there are no accessible taxis available, those driving will find accessible car parking spaces free of charge, managed by Babergh District Council.

Waiting for your train is not a hassle, as there is ample seating despite the absence of a formal waiting room. Free parking with 140 spaces means you can breeze in and out at your convenience, never needing to worry about the meter running.

Station Facilities and Amenities

At Rickmansworth station, whilst there is no dedicated ticket office, travelers can make use of ticket machines to purchase tickets on-the-go. However, it is worth noting that tickets purchased online cannot be collected from this station. Additional facilities are limited, including no provision for lost property outside of typical weekday hours, and the lack of an accessible toilet or baby changing facilities.

For those requiring additional assistance, there are help points with staff providing information during your visit. Remember to book Passenger Assist for a smooth experience, especially if assistance is needed during your trip. Refreshments and shops are also within easy reach at the station, making it convenient for a quick bite or shopping spree before departure.

Onward Travel Options

Rickmansworth station is well-positioned for those looking to continue their journey after the train. With a minicab office right outside, travelers can easily hop into a taxi if their destination isn't directly served by the rail network. The station also connects to the Metropolitan line, making it a convenient starting point for journeys across London's extensive underground network. For those heading further afield, connections to major airports like Gatwick, Heathrow, Stansted, and London City can easily be made by traveling to central London.
